(208) 282-4636 921 South 8th Avenue | Pocatello, Idaho, 83...With online PT programs, on campus learning is not the only time you will need to report to a physical location. This may also be necessary for completing your clinical semesters. However, this part of the program may often be completed at a placement site local to the hybrid student! Now may be a perfect time to explore doctorate of physical therapy degree programs online. According to the United States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), the median annual wages for physical therapists in 2022 was $97,720.
